Privately-owned AmTrust’s bankruptcy a bad sign for regionals
AmTrust Financial, a privately held regional bank holding company based in Cleveland, has just filed for bankruptcy. With well over $10 billion in assets, AmTrust Bank is fairly large. The circumstances surrounding its failure are unusual…